Student 3:
When looking at a data set that expresses a normal distribution I would look to see of it is symmetrical about the center, this would be the mean. The mean, median, and mode should also all be the same. I would also look for the point of inflexion about the standard deviation. An example of normal distribution would be IQ scores. Say you are comparing a student’s IQ score to those of other students and that student scored better than 99.87% of the other test takers. This would be referred to as a percentile.

Student 5:
A normal distribution would be symmetrical and the mean, median, and mode would be the same. For example, the amount of milk a cow produces in one day. This is a continuous random variable because it can have any value over a continuous span. During a single day, a cow might yield an amount of milk that can be any value between 0 gallons and 5 gallons. It would be possible to get 4.12 gallons, because the cow is not restricted to the discrete amounts of 0, 1, 2, 3, 4, or 5 gallons.
